/**
 * @file
 * @brief Contains the declarations for the SubhingeBase class.
 */

#pragma once

#include "Karana/SOADyn/CoordBase.h"
#include "Karana/SOADyn/Defs.h"

namespace Karana::Dynamics {

    namespace kc = Karana::Core;
    namespace km = Karana::Math;

    class HingeBase;
    class CoordData;

    /**
     * @class SubhingeBase
     * @brief Represents the abstract base class for articulation subhinges
     *
     * This class is the base class for subhinges from which physical
     * and compound subhinge classes are derived. See \sref{subhinges_sec}
     * for more discussion about subhinges.
     */
    class SubhingeBase : public CoordBase {

        /* for access to _parent_hinge member */
        friend class HingeOnode;
        friend class PhysicalHinge;

        // For access to isOriented.
        friend class CompoundSubhinge;

      public:
        /**
         * @brief SubhingeBase destructor.
         */
        virtual ~SubhingeBase();

        /**
         * @brief Returns the type string of the object.
         *
         * @param brief if true, return the short form of the class type name, else the full type
         *        name
         * @return The type string.
         */
        std::string_view typeString(bool brief = true) const noexcept = 0;

        /**
         * @brief Helper method to return the subhinge type
         *
         * @return the subhinge type
         */
        virtual SubhingeType subhingeType() const = 0;

        /**
         * @brief Helper method to return the string name for a SubhingeType subhinge type
         *
         * @param shtype the subhinge type
         * @return the subhinge type as a string
         */
        static std::string subhingeTypeString(SubhingeType shtype);

        /**
         * @brief Set the prescribed flag for the subhinge
         * @param flag the enable/disable flag
         */
        virtual void setPrescribed(bool flag) { _prescribed = flag; }

        /**
         * @brief Return the prescribed flag for the subhinge
         * @return the prescribed mode status
         */
        bool getPrescribed() const { return _prescribed; }

        /**
         * @brief Return the parent hinge for the subhinge
         * @return the PhysicalHinge parent hinge
         */
        const kc::ks_ptr<HingeBase> &parentHinge() const { return _parent_hinge; }

      protected:
        /**
         * @brief Constructs a SubhingeBase.
         * @param nm the name for the subhinge
         * @param id the id for the subhinge
         * @param hge the parent hinge
         */
        SubhingeBase(std::string_view nm, kc::id_t id, kc::ks_ptr<HingeBase> hge);

      protected:
        /** the parent hinge */
        kc::ks_ptr<HingeBase> _parent_hinge = nullptr;

        /** flag indicating whether the subhinge is prescribed */
        bool _prescribed = false;
    };

} // namespace Karana::Dynamics
